Gracefully adorning Ayodhya’s sacred skyline, the Shri Ram Janmbhoomi Temple stands as a timeless symbol of devotion and pride. Spread over 70 acres, it is built in majestic Nagara style from Bansi Paharpur pink sandstone, adorned with intricate carvings and Ramayana sculptures, harmoniously blending ancient tradition with modern craftsmanship. The sanctum enshrines the divine idol of Balak Ram, radiating serenity and devotion. Leading to the temple, the grand Ram Path – a wide, illuminated boulevard adorned with traditional facades and murals – symbolizes Ayodhya’s spiritual renaissance. Emerging after decades of faith and perseverance, the Ram Mandir now stands as a beacon of India’s unity, artistry, and timeless heritage.
